The POKéMON PC storage system made by Lanette has been updated by her older sister Brigette and is now available for all trainers to use!
There are 25 boxes to use and each can hold 60 POKéMON or POKéMON eggs. Like Lanette's PC system you can change the wallpaper, mark your POKéMON, check their summarys, and more easily arrange them.
Once you upload them to Box and quit you're able to switch game paks and start Box back up. From there you can send them down to the other game! Makes for an easier and faster method of trading!
A new thing is the option to view a list of them similar to the kind introduced in POKéMON Stadium. You can have them listed by alphabetical order, POKéDEX number, species, etc. Their stats are easily viewable as are their natures, abilities, amount of ribbons, all that good stuff. It's also a good way to check how many POKéMON you have in total!
By the way don't think you'll have to move each and every PKMN one by one to and from Box. By holding in the A button and dragging the cursor along you can easily select anywhere from 2 to all of the POKéMON in a box. Then release the A button and all of the ones you highlighted will be moved to wherever you want in one shot.
The new options and ease of use make this a pleasurable update to the R/S PC system.
But in order to access this in Ruby, Sapphire, Fire Red, or Leaf Green, you'll need to have registered at least 100 POKéMON in your POKéDEX. Also, until you get the National POKéDEX in Fire Red & Leaf Green, you cannot transfer any POKéMON besides the original 151 from Box to those versions.
